tutorials.de Buch-Aktion 05/2012
ERLEDIGT
JA
ANTWORTEN
11
ZUGRIFFE
504
EMPFEHLEN
  • An Twitter übertragen
  • An Facebook übertragen
AUF DIESES THEMA
ANTWORTEN
  1. #1
    Benzol Benzol ist offline Mitglied Brokat
    Registriert seit
    Nov 2003
    Beiträge
    326
    Guten Morgen wünsche ich,
    mich wundert, das bei meinem Script für die Bildverkleinerung einer Gallerie Rechts und Unten Schwarze und Weisse Ränder zu sehen sind.
    http://www.photosterner.de/seite/Bil...PGvorschau.jpg

    Im Prinzip wird nicht mehr gemacht, als das Größe Bild verkleinert in ein kleines, leeres Bild eingefügt. Wisst Ihr, warum soetwas zu stande kommt und wie man das verhindert?
     

  2. #2
    Sicaine Tutorials.de Gastzugang
    Du wirst halt warscheinlich die Größe des neuen Bildes falsch berechnet haben
     

  3. #3
    Benzol Benzol ist offline Mitglied Brokat
    Registriert seit
    Nov 2003
    Beiträge
    326
    Was soll ich da falsch berechnet haben? Das leere Bild ist genauso groß, wie das große Bild nach dem verkleinern...
     

  4. #4
    Registriert seit
    Jul 2003
    Ort
    Gronau, Nordrhein-Westfalen, Germany, Germany
    Beiträge
    634
    Poste doch einfach mal Code, villeicht kann dir dann jmd. sagen ob dus falsch berechnet hast
     

  5. #5
    DeluXe DeluXe ist offline Funkjoker
    Registriert seit
    Jul 2004
    Ort
    Offenburg
    Beiträge
    847
    Hi,
    am besten zeigst du mal wie du es verkleinert hast, so aus dem Stehgreif fällt mir da nichts ein.

    byez
     

  6. #6
    Benzol Benzol ist offline Mitglied Brokat
    Registriert seit
    Nov 2003
    Beiträge
    326
    Habe hier vonner Arbeit aus leider keine Möglichkeit, an den QUellcode zu kommen.
    Ich weiss aber noch soviel, das ich ein jpg erstellt habe mit den größen die es braucht. Dann habe ich das Orginalbild genommen und in das neue Bild klein kopiert. Auch in der selben größe. Das sind glaube ich keine berechnungsfehler. Zumal es auf simson-umbau.de auch schon vorgekommen ist, das Bilder falsché Ränder hatten.
    Hier z.B.
    http://www.simson-umbau.de/images/usr_img/titles/1.jpg
    Und das ist kein einzellfall. Genauso ist er vorgekommen, das die Bilder richtig waren.
    Bei der Seite wars mir zeihmlich egal, aber bei der neuen sollte das schon richtig gut aussehen.
     

  7. #7
    Avatar von Timbonet
    Timbonet Timbonet ist offline Mitglied Brilliant
    Registriert seit
    Jun 2003
    Ort
    Griesheim (Hessen)
    Beiträge
    800
    Ohne den Code ist es natürlich schwer.. Da es sich immer um einen Pixel handelt: Könnte es vielleicht ein Rundungsfehler sein?
     

  8. #8
    Benzol Benzol ist offline Mitglied Brokat
    Registriert seit
    Nov 2003
    Beiträge
    326
    Nein ich habe eine fixe größe. d.h. ich Berechne die größe des Vorschaubildes nicht sondern ich sage fest so und so viele Pixel breite und höhe.
     

  9. #9
    Registriert seit
    Jul 2003
    Ort
    Gronau, Nordrhein-Westfalen, Germany, Germany
    Beiträge
    634
    Warum machst du es nicht einfach so das du das Bild lädst, verkleinerst und neu speicherst statt es erst zu erstellen und reinzukopieren?
     

  10. #10
    Sicaine Tutorials.de Gastzugang
    oO weil man eine Bildresource nich kleiner machen kann? Btw: Ich machs ebenfalls so und ich hab keinen Rand und hatte auch keinen weshalb es definitiv ein Scriptfehler ist :P
     

  11. #11
    Registriert seit
    Jul 2003
    Ort
    Gronau, Nordrhein-Westfalen, Germany, Germany
    Beiträge
    634
    @Benzol
    Schick mir mal ne PN, villeicht kann ich dir da weiterhelfen mit ner Funktion oder so
     

  12. #12
    Benzol Benzol ist offline Mitglied Brokat
    Registriert seit
    Nov 2003
    Beiträge
    326
    SO, hier dann mal der Quellcode...

    PHP-Code:
        $scource     imagecreatefromjpeg($file); 
        
    $destination imagecreatetruecolor($width$height); 
        
        
    imagecopyresized($destination$scource0000$width$heightimagesx($scource), imagesy($scource)); 
        
        
    imagejpeg($destination"../Bilder/Portfolio/$kategorie/Vorschau/".$bild."vorschau."."jpg"100); 
        
        
    move_uploaded_file("$tmp_name","../Bilder/Portfolio/$kategorie/$bild"); 
    Ich habe das Script damals auch hier gefunden... nachgeschrieben, versucht zu lernen etc. Aber warum das so nicht richtig funktioniert... weis ich leider nicht.
     

Ähnliche Themen

  1. Elemente verkleinern beim Fenster-Verkleinern
    Von YelloW22 im Forum Swing, Java2D/3D, SWT, JFace
    Antworten: 3
    Letzter Beitrag: 29.06.10, 20:19
  2. Verkleinern von Bildern
    Von thesecretboy im Forum Java
    Antworten: 1
    Letzter Beitrag: 29.05.07, 14:08
  3. Einen ganzen Ordnern mit Bildern verkleinern?
    Von Kalma im Forum Photoshop
    Antworten: 6
    Letzter Beitrag: 11.12.06, 10:30
  4. Pixelfehler beim Verlaufswerkzeug
    Von sirvenue im Forum Photoshop
    Antworten: 4
    Letzter Beitrag: 26.06.04, 23:06
  5. verkleinern von Bildern ohne Qualitaetsverlust?
    Von Milchmann im Forum Photoshop
    Antworten: 2
    Letzter Beitrag: 21.05.02, 15:16